The history of Razorback football dates back to the late 19th century, marking the beginning of a storied tradition that has grown alongside the University of Arkansas. Founded in 1894, the Razorback football program quickly established itself as a formidable force in collegiate sports. The team's evolution over the decades reflects the broader trends in American football, with strategic innovations and changes in the game reflecting the dynamic nature of the sport.

The 20th century brought about significant changes for the Razorbacks, including their entry into the Southwest Conference in 1915. This move elevated the team's profile and set the stage for memorable rivalries and classic matchups that have become a cherished part of Razorback lore. The team's success during this era, highlighted by several conference championships and bowl appearances, solidified its place in college football history.
